What Features Should You Look for in the Best Outdoor Cat Tent?
When searching for the best outdoor cat tent, consider the following features:
- Durability: Look for tents made from high-quality materials that can withstand various weather conditions and rough outdoor use.
- Ventilation: Good airflow is essential to keep your cat comfortable, so ensure the tent has mesh panels or openings to allow for proper ventilation.
- Portability: A lightweight and easy-to-carry tent is vital for outdoor adventures, making it simple to transport and set up wherever you go.
- Size: Choose a tent that offers enough space for your cat to move around comfortably, as well as room for additional cats or toys if needed.
- UV Protection: Selecting a tent with UV-blocking materials helps protect your cat from harmful sun rays during hot days outdoors.
- Easy Setup: Look for designs that are simple to assemble and disassemble, allowing you to set up the tent quickly without hassle.
- Safety Features: Ensure the tent has features such as secure zippers and sturdy frames to keep your cat safe from predators and prevent escape.
Durability is crucial in an outdoor cat tent because it needs to endure exposure to the elements and the wear and tear from your cat’s activities. Tents constructed from robust materials like ripstop nylon or heavy-duty fabrics are preferable, as they resist tearing and fading over time.
Ventilation is important for your cat’s comfort, especially in warmer weather. Tents equipped with mesh panels not only provide airflow but also allow your cat to observe their surroundings while staying protected from insects.
Portability is key for outdoor use; a lightweight tent that can be easily folded or packed makes spontaneous trips to parks or campsites much more enjoyable. Look for tents that come with carrying bags for added convenience.
Size matters because a cramped space can be uncomfortable for your cat. A good outdoor cat tent should provide enough room for your pet to lie down, stretch, and move around freely, which can help reduce anxiety while outdoors.
UV protection is essential to prevent overheating and sunburn in cats, particularly those with lighter fur. Tents that feature UV-blocking fabrics can help keep your pet safe during sunny outings.
Easy setup can significantly enhance your experience, especially if you’re on the go. Tents that utilize pop-up designs or straightforward assembly instructions allow you to spend more time enjoying the outdoors with your cat and less time struggling with complicated setups.
Safety features like secure zippers and strong frames are vital for peace of mind. A well-designed tent will help prevent your cat from escaping while also keeping potential predators at bay, ensuring a safe and enjoyable outdoor experience.

Why Is Ventilation Important in an Outdoor Cat Tent?
Ventilation is crucial in an outdoor cat tent because it ensures a comfortable and safe environment for cats, preventing overheating and allowing for proper air circulation.
According to the American Association of Feline Practitioners, proper ventilation in enclosures can help reduce the risk of heat stress and respiratory issues in cats. Cats are prone to overheating due to their fur coats, and in a confined space, temperatures can rise quickly, especially in direct sunlight. Adequate airflow mitigates this risk, promoting a healthier environment.
The underlying mechanism involves the relationship between temperature, humidity, and airflow. When a cat tent lacks sufficient ventilation, heat and moisture can accumulate, creating a stifling atmosphere that can lead to distress or health problems for the animal. Good ventilation allows fresh air to enter while stale air is expelled, maintaining a balanced and stable environment. This is particularly important during warmer months when outdoor temperatures can fluctuate significantly, impacting a cat’s well-being.

How Should You Set Up and Maintain the Best Outdoor Cat Tent?
To set up and maintain the best outdoor cat tent, consider the following key factors:
- Location: Choose a safe and sheltered area for the tent to protect your cat from harsh weather and potential predators.
- Material Quality: Opt for a tent made from durable, weather-resistant materials to ensure longevity and safety for your cat.
- Size and Space: Ensure the tent is spacious enough for your cat to move around comfortably and includes features like perches or hiding spots.
- Ventilation: Look for tents with adequate ventilation to keep the air fresh inside and prevent overheating on sunny days.
- Secure Anchoring: Use stakes or weights to anchor the tent securely to the ground, preventing it from being blown away or tipping over.
- Regular Cleaning: Maintain hygiene by periodically cleaning the tent and checking for any signs of wear or damage that could compromise your cat’s safety.
- Enrichment Features: Include toys, scratching posts, or climbing structures inside the tent to keep your cat engaged and happy.
Choosing a location that is both safe and sheltered is crucial for your cat’s well-being. Look for areas that are away from busy pathways and provide some cover from the elements, such as trees or overhangs, which can protect against rain and direct sunlight.
Material quality is essential; select a tent made from tough, waterproof fabrics that can withstand UV rays and resist tearing. This not only prolongs the tent’s lifespan but also ensures your cat is safe from the elements and potential hazards.
The size and space of the tent should accommodate your cat’s size and personality. A larger tent allows for freedom of movement and the inclusion of different areas for lounging, climbing, or hiding, which can help reduce stress and provide a more enjoyable environment.
Ventilation is important to ensure your cat remains cool and comfortable, especially during warmer months. Look for tents designed with mesh panels or windows that allow airflow without compromising security.
Secure anchoring of the tent is vital to keep it stable during windy conditions. Using sturdy stakes or weights can help prevent the tent from moving or collapsing, ensuring your cat remains safe inside.
Regular cleaning is necessary to maintain a healthy environment for your cat. Check the tent frequently for dirt, debris, or any signs of wear, and clean it according to the manufacturer’s instructions to prevent mold or pests from becoming a problem.
Including enrichment features can significantly enhance your cat’s outdoor experience. Toys, scratching surfaces, or platforms for climbing can stimulate your cat’s natural instincts and keep them entertained while they enjoy the fresh air.
